WebJan 24, 2015 · The "vertex form" of a quadratic function is f (x) = a (x - h)2 + k. The graph of f is a parabola with vertex (h, k). If a > 0, then (h, K) is the lowest point of the graph and … WebSep 7, 2024 · In this way, we can get the equation’s standard form into vertex form. WebSome quadratic expressions can be factored as perfect squares. For example, x²+6x+9=(x+3)². However, even if an expression isn't a perfect square, we can turn it into one by adding a constant number. For example, x²+6x+5 isn't a perfect square, but if we add 4 we get (x+3)². This, in essence, is the method of *completing the square*. WebThis calculator will allow you to get a quadratic function that you provide into vertex form, showing all the steps.
